Understanding Injectable Hormone Therapy

Injectable hormone therapy utilizes hormones directly into the system to balance hormonal levels. This approach can be used to treat a variety of issues, including menopause, low testosterone, and transgender hormone replacement therapy. Physicians will meticulously evaluate your personal needs to identify the right type and dosage of substances for you.

It's essential to speak with a qualified medical professional to understand if injectable hormone therapy is feasible for your needs. They can provide guidance on the pros, potential side effects, and ongoing care required.

Understanding Injectable Steroid Mechanisms

Injectable steroids function by mimicking the effects of naturally produced hormones in the body. These synthetically manufactured compounds, primarily testosterone, are administered directly into the bloodstream targeting various tissues and organs. Upon entry, they bind to specific proteins within cells, triggering a cascade of biochemical reactions.   • Some steroids, like testosterone, are anabolic, encouraging protein synthesis and muscle growth.
  • Alternative steroids, such as corticosteroids, have swelling-reducing effects, used to alleviate conditions like arthritis and asthma.

However, misused use of injectable steroids can lead a range of negative effects, including liver damage, cardiovascular problems, and hormonal imbalances.
